Pumpkin Cheesecake Bread [Vegan]

Vegan Pumpkin Cheesecake Bread: A Recipe to Savor

To create this scrumptious vegan pumpkin cheesecake bread, you’ll need the following ingredients:

1 can (15 ounces) of pumpkin puree
1 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
3 teaspoons baking powder
1 teaspoon baking soda
1 teaspoon salt
1/4 cup sugar
1/4 cup non-dairy butter, melted
1/2 cup vegan cream cheese, softened
1 large egg replacement (such as flax or chia)
1 teaspoon vanilla extract

For the Bread:

  • 1 flax egg* (1 tablespoon ground flaxseed + 3 tablespoons water), or omit if you prefer a drier loaf.
  • 1 cup pumpkin purée
  • 3/4 cup coconut sugar
  • Approximately 60ml of liquid-state coconut oil or a suitable vegetable oil alternative.
  • Optional: 1/3 cup vegan sour cream (omit for a denser, less moist crumb)
  • 2 teaspoons vanilla extract
  • 2 teaspoons cinnamon
  • 1 teaspoon pumpkin pie spice
  • 1/2 teaspoon ground nutmeg
  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1/2 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on baking soda
  • The classic seasoning addition.

For the Cream Cheese Filling:

  • One 8-ounce container of softened vegan cream cheese.
  • 1/3 cup granulated sugar
  • 3 tablespoons all-purpose flour

For the Icing:

  • 1 cup powdered sugar
  • 3 tablespoons almond milk
  • Toasted walnuts, for topping (optional)

Vibrant Vibe: Delicious Vegan Pumpkin Cheesecake Bread Recipe

To Make the Batter:

  1. Preheat oven to 350°F. Coat a 9×5-inch loaf pan with a thin layer of coconut oil or vegan butter to ensure easy release and non-stick performance.
  2. Whisk together in a large bowl the initial nine ingredients, including ground nutmeg, until fully incorporated. Combine the flour, baking powder, baking soda, and optional salt, folding gently with a spatula or spoon until the ingredients are just incorporated without overmixing. Set aside. Two-thirds of the batter are poured into the prepared pan, its surface smoothed out by a gentle spatula stroke, carefully coaxed into every nook and cranny.
  3. Two-thirds of the batter is then poured into the prepared pan, with the top smoothed over using a spatula to ensure even coverage and a secure fit along the edges. Set aside.

To craft the creamy core of this delightful pastry:

  1. Combine all ingredients in a large bowl and whisk until well incorporated.

To Make the Bread:

  1. Spread the cream cheese filling evenly across the bread, using a spatula to gently smooth the surface, while also ensuring the filling is pushed into all corners and crevices.
  2. Smoothly spreading the residual pumpkin batter atop the cream cheese layer, use a gentle touch to avoid disrupting its uniformity, then carefully coax the mixture towards the periphery and corners of the baking vessel. Bake for approximately 48 minutes, or until the crust has puffed into a golden brown dome and the internal temperature reaches 190°F (88°C), as confirmed by a toothpick that emerges with only a hint of moisture and no remaining batter.
  3. Bake for approximately 48 minutes, or until the crust assumes a domed shape, a warm golden hue, and the core is thoroughly cooked, ascertained by a toothpick inserted into the centre emerging either completely clean or bearing only a few tantalizing crumbs, devoid of any residual batter. Although the top may appear to be done, it is still crucial to ensure the inside is fully cooked; thus, at the 35-minute mark, cover the pan with a sheet of foil, carefully draping it over the contents to maintain heat and prevent overcooking. Baking times may fluctuate significantly due to variations in the moisture levels of pumpkin, cream cheese, as well as regional climates and oven calibration discrepancies. Let bread rise; don’t rush the process. After baking, allow bread to rest undisturbed in the pan for approximately 15 minutes to allow internal temperature to stabilize and the crumb to set, then transfer it to a wire rack to finish cooling.

To Make the Icing:

  1. Combining the sweet and creamy icing ingredients, I top this decadent dessert with a crunchy sprinkle of toasted walnuts for added texture and flavor. Freshly baked bread can be stored airtight at room temperature for as long as seven days, while extended storage is possible by freezing it for a maximum of six months.

Nutritional Information

Total Nutrients: 3329 calories, 519g carbs, 128g fat, 27g protein, 1328mg sodium, 371g sugar.

Calories per serving: 416 | Carbohydrates: 65g | Fat: 16g | Protein: 3g | Sodium: 166mg | Sugar: 46g
